NFL.com ranks Top 25 QB's of All Time: Jim Kelly #21
NoHuddleKelly12 replied to StHustle's topic in The Stadium Wall Archives
So, you give the team around Kelly all the credit for the wins? Using that kind of cherry picking logic, let's extrapolate Kelly's rating to match up with Bills playoff wins only. His rating for those playoff games where the Bills won (9 of them) is 84.4, better than Elway & Marino's cumulative playoff ratings over the same period (79, 77 respectively) Further, over the course of their complete NFL careers, Kelly also has the same 84.4 rating, Elway's is 79.9, and Marino's is 86.4. All of these numbers are available on https://www.pro-football-reference.com/players/. I readily admit I have a bias towards Kelly, but it is what it is. He's a first ballot HOFer, deservedly so, and you can never bifurcate the achievements of the Bills during their run between Kelly and everyone else on the roster. They are inextricably intertwined. He was the cog that made the wheel go, and directed the offensive playcalling himself at the line--so if Thurman rips off a big run because the defensive alignment that Kelly recognized put Thum in position to make plays for example, then you have to give Kelly extra credit there as well, not some bean counter in the press box calling plays from that ivory tower. I won't ever take anything away from Marino or Elway, but to say that Kelly is heads and shoulders beneath them in quality, is simply not backed up by the evidence. -
